We live down the street from this cute little bakery, which means we’ve visited more than just a few times. From their selections of different coffees to their roscón and from their homemade lemon and orange loafs to the little items on their shelves, we’ve enjoyed it all.

The atmosphere is cute and quaint with places to sit inside and outside. The staff is always nice and helpful whenever we visit, especially if we’re looking for something particular.

The only criticism I have is that a lot of their goods, especially baked goods, are a little pricy. Albeit they are delicious, they’re still a little steep for my liking.

This location is in my neighborhood, I don't come often, not because Santa Teresa has poor products, in fact, their products are top notch. However, the level of service from the employees are subpar. Just sheer surliness and apathy. I know it's a bit normal for most wait-staff in Madrid to be a bit 'rough around the edges' but today there was no eye contact or an acknowledgement when I said "thank you." Pésimo y carísimo! Fuimos de casualidad pq estábamos de visita en Aravaca y nos pareció que tenía buena pinta pero los productos son como en cualquier otra pastelería y la experiencia fue PENOSA. Hay una camarera rubia que es la que cobra (no la que atiende las mesas) que parece que te está haciendo un favor atendiéndote, si lo hace, porque si puede te ignora mientras hace sus cosas o habla con otra mientras tú estás de pie esperando a pedir o pagar. El local tiene 4 mesas y una barra por lo que nos tocó esperar media hora para poder desayunar más otros 10 minutos cuando quieres pagar pq como he dicho pagas en caja y se tarda. Y ya por último los precios...¡¡Para empezar no te avisan de nada!! Cobran aparte café y tostada y te sale por unos 4.5€ (sin zumo) y eso si no pides colacao como nosotros que íbamos con 2 niños donde entonces croissant y colacao se ponen en 5€ cada desayuno. Y para colmo no te avisan ni que el colacao va aparte, ni que el croissant es de cereales (cuando ves que es para niños) ni que la tostada es integral. No sabenos si fue error o es así sin más, pq no pensamos volver, pero avisar tienen que avisar ¡¡aunque sólo sea por intolerancias!!
